Matthijs Steeneveld founded Uitgeverij Positieve Psychologie Nederland in 2018 as a publishing company to spread knowledge about positive psychology. He has authored multiple books including 'Optimisme - Hoop - Veerkracht - Zelfvertrouwen' and '#imperfectlife' published by Boom. He co-created the Verwonderkaartspel (Wonder Card Game) with Tomer Kedar and the Sterke Kantenkaartspel with Anouk van den Berg.
